Output 2f134902976024d4ab095d98430d2cccbfd9a6c3dfda0967c6cc158920bcc3af:1

value
3986707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3fc90de5963f3a14086acb40417970cc1ef198 OP_EQUAL
address
3Jfp27HvtuujSPK45hVCLowhUWKSuyJFJm
transaction
2f134902976024d4ab095d98430d2cccbfd9a6c3dfda0967c6cc158920bcc3af
confirmations
446124
spent
true